BASE-RAY TAPPINGS- Tapped 3/4" top and bot- tom of end sections. A 3/4" x 1/8" vent bushing is furnished with each Base-Ray Assembly. Only one air vent location need be used.
Copper tubing is not recommended for steam appli­cations due to high heat loss through the tubing and thermal expansion noise.
Maximum recommended length for steam applications is 10 lineal feet.
Base-Ray® Assembly Chart
BASE-RAY Assemblies up to and including 6 lineal ft. are shipped in one piece.
Longer Assemblies are shipped in two or more pieces or sub­assemblies, none of which exceeds 6 lineal ft.

Types of Systems
Hydronic Heating Systems are classi¿ ed according to the pip- ing arrangement and heating medium employed. BASE-RAY is very versatile in that it may be used in almost all types of systems as noted below:
1. Series Loop Forced Circulation Hot Water
2. One-Pipe Forced Circulation Hot Water
3. Two-Pipe Reverse Return Gravity or Forced Circulation Hot Water
4. Two-Pipe Steam or Vapor.
It is not recommended that BASE-RAY be used in a One-Pipe Steam System.
System Description
1. Series Loop is a forced circulation hot water heating system
with the BASE-RAY Assemblies connected so that all the water À owing through a circuit passes through each series- connected Assembly in the circuit. Thus, the Assemblies serve as portions of the main.
2. One-Pipe is a forced circulation hot water heating system utilizing one continuous main from boiler supply to boiler return. BASE-RAY Assemblies are connected to this pipe or main by two smaller pipes known as branches. When connecting these branches to the main, one of the standard
tees is replaced by a special tee frequently called a one-pipe
¿ tting. These one-pipe ¿ ttings cause a portion of the water À owing through the main to pass through the BASE-RAY
Assemblies and back to the main again.
3. Two-Pipe Reverse Return is a gravity or forced circulation hot water heating system utilizing one main to carry heated water from the boiler to the BASE-RAY Assemblies and a second main to carry the cooled water from the Assemblies back to the boiler. The Assemblies are connected to the return main in the reverse order from that in which they are connected to the supply main. Very few designers use this type of system for residential applications, since there is no difference between the heating qualities of this system and the other two hot water systems.
4. Two-Pipe Steam or Vapor Systems are steam systems in which each BASE-RAY Assembly is provided with two piping connections, and where steam and condensate À ow in separate mains and branches. The Vapor system differs from the low pressure system only in the type of air valve used.
